Abstract

A downhole telemetry system for transmitting electromagnetic signals wirelessly in a bore hole comprises a surface modem (230) coupled to an antenna and a downhole modem (220) coupled to an antenna (201). The modems (220, 230) communicate using discrete multitone (DMT) modulation over a first set of frequency subchannels for uplink communications to a surface computer (234) where the telemetry data may be processed. Bidirectional communication may be implemented, whereby downlink communications are effected over a second set of frequency subchannels. The number of bits transmitted over a frequency subchannel is determined in a configuration process and may be determined dynamically so as to optimise the communications for the downhole conditions, improving telemetry data rate and reliability.
